The Adena “Giants” and the Search for a Lost White Race

The year was 1830. The conspiracy was — in a word — ludicrous. Earthen mounds and artifacts had been discovered on the land of a white Ohioan named Thomas Worthington. Dating revealed these artifacts were at least 1000 years old, and possibly older than the pyramids. This was a major…
